: I wish FIRST would just find another way to announce or CALL teams for the upcoming matches

Hello All;

I wholeheartedly agree with this sentiment. I've long advocated that FIRST get a low power FM band transmitter (about $125 for a nice one, $250 for a super one) and broadcast their annoucements on a blank spot on the FM dial...

That way team members could stay in touch with who's up even when out in the arena scouting (what teen doesn't have access to a Walkman?), and each team could have a radio at their pit station, so we could all here things without the need for an extremely loud PA system.

Yes, it's legal.

Heck, even real estate agents sometimes use this 'trick' by putting such radios in houses that are for sale.

We're supposed to be technological leaders - let's lead!
